koyli Posted 24 January , 2004 Share Posted 24 January , 2004 Hello, I'm looking for a photograph of : 2nd Lieutenant CHARLES ALFRED PIGOT-MOODIE 6th Reserve Battn. RIFLE BRIGADE (THE PRINCE CONSORT’S OWN) attending 2nd Battn. ROYAL IRISH RIFLES. Died on the 13th January 1915. After only having been with the unit for 39 days. He had joined the battalion on the 5.12.14 and had come out with a batch of reinforcements for the unit. The only photograph I have been able to find is the one in Bond of Sacrifice, however it is of very poor quality. PIGOT-MOODIE spent some time at HARROW school and I know he had a photograph taken locally.
